What's The Definition Of Pretension?

pretension
If someone has pretensions to something, they claim to be or do that thing.
variable noun: If you say that someone has pretensions, you disapprove of them because they claim or pretend that they are more important than they really are.

pretension in American English
a pretext or allegation

pretension in American English 1
noun: the laying of a claim to something

pretension in American English 2
transitive verb: to apply tension to (reinforcing strands) before the concrete is poured

pretension in British English
noun: a false or unsupportable claim, esp to merit, worth, or importance
